要实现标题的中英切换,可以通过以下步骤操作:\n\n1. 创建一个配置文件,用于存放中英文标题的配置信息。例如,可以创建一个 titleConfig.js 文件。\n\n2. 在 titleConfig.js 文件中定义一个对象,包含中英文标题的键值对。例如:\n\njavascript\nconst titleConfig = {\n en: 'English Title',\n zh: '中文标题'\n};\n\nexport default titleConfig;\n\n\n3. 在需要使用标题的 Vue 组件中,引入 titleConfig.js 文件,并添加一个计算属性,用于获取当前语言对应的标题。例如:\n\njavascript\nimport titleConfig from '@/path/to/titleConfig.js';\n\nexport default {\n computed: {\n pageTitle() {\n // 获取当前语言\n const language = this.$store.state.language; // 假设语言存储在 Vuex 的 state 中\n\n // 返回对应语言的标题\n return titleConfig[language];\n }\n },\n // ...\n};\n\n\n4. 在组件的模板中,使用 pageTitle 计算属性来显示标题。例如:\n\nhtml\n<template>\n <div>\n <h1>{{ pageTitle }}</h1>\n <!-- 其他页面内容 -->\n </div>\n</template>\n\n\n这样,在切换语言时,只需要修改 Vuex 中的语言状态,页面的标题就会自动更新为对应语言的标题。


原文地址: https://www.cveoy.top/t/topic/pIRg 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录